To create a game list of several batch files, you set up a new emulator like the screenshots below:
You leave the executable field blank. After you have it working like you want it, you can set the windows state to: hidden. Don't forget to refresh the main game list if needed (Right click while viewing the Bat file game list).
AVIs would be similiar except you would specify the executable. This would be whatever app you want to use to play the AVI. For example:
C:\Program Files\Windows Media Player\wmplayer.exe
For the complicated solution of mixing emulators in one game list, see the pinned topic near the top of this forum entitled:
"GameLists: Multiple emuls in same list work-around solution"
